一. Ubuntu安装SSH
(1)先检查下系统是否已经安装SSH
sudo dpkg -l | grep ssh
若没有出现相应的结果则进行相关安装
sudo apt update ; sudo apt install openssh*
(2)检查SSH服务是否开启
sudo ps -e | grep ssh
若SSH服务没有开启可通过service
命令就行开启
#启动
sudo service ssh start
#停止
sudo service ssh stop
#重新启动
sudo service ssh restart
Ubuntu中SSH服务安装后默认开机自启,如需关闭可对配置文件/etc/init/ssh.conf进行更改,注释掉其中的start on runlevel [2345]
,也可选择性的去掉某些runlevel,使得其在某些runlevel中依旧能够开机启动。
二. Linux系统SSH远程登陆服务器
Linux系统安装SSH后直接使用如下命令即可远程登陆
ssh user@Host
其中user为远程服务器端的一个用户名,Host为主机名,一般为服务器ip地址,也可进行重命名方便后续的多次登录。
#使用服务器端名为sxuan的用户登陆某IP地址的主机
ssh sxuan@192.168.1.110
更改配置文件,重命名服务器主机名以方便重复登录
#创建配置文件
vim ~/.ssh/config
#输入更改的配置信息
Host alias_servername #如Hulab
User username #如sxuan
Hostname ip地址 #如192.168.1.110
设置好后便可以进行如下登陆
ssh Hulab
三. Windows使用Putty进行远程登陆
(1)官网下载putty进行安装
(2)运行Putty,填入服务器ip地址进行登陆便可。